Isolating Citation Trends in Meta AI

To begin your audit, you must establish a clear view of your current citation performance within the Meta AI platform. By setting your date range to the last 30 days, you create a comparative window that highlights recent fluctuations in how your brand is being referenced.

Establishing a baseline is critical for understanding whether a drop is an anomaly or a sustained trend. Use the Trakkr dashboard to filter data specifically for Meta AI, ensuring that your analysis remains focused on the unique behavior of this specific answer engine.

  • Set the date range to the last 30 days for accurate comparative analysis of your citation data
  • Filter your citation intelligence data specifically for the Meta AI platform to isolate relevant performance metrics
  • Establish a baseline citation rate for your blog content to identify what constitutes normal performance levels
  • Monitor citation rates over time to distinguish between platform-wide shifts and specific drops in your brand visibility

Identifying High-Impact Citation Loss

Once you have established your baseline, you can proceed to pinpoint the specific URLs that have seen the most significant decline in mentions. Sorting your data by the change in citation count allows you to quickly identify the most critical gaps in your current coverage.

Comparing current citation frequency against historical benchmarks provides the necessary context to understand the severity of the loss. This step is essential for isolating blog posts that have dropped out of key AI-generated answers, which directly impacts your organic traffic and brand authority.

  • Use the citation intelligence dashboard to sort your content by the change in total citation count
  • Compare your current citation frequency against historical benchmarks to identify significant performance declines
  • Isolate specific blog posts that have dropped out of key AI-generated answers to prioritize your recovery efforts
  • Analyze the delta in citation counts to determine which content pieces require immediate optimization or technical review

Taking Action on Citation Gaps

After identifying the affected blog posts, you must investigate the context of the AI answers where your brand was previously cited. Understanding why a citation was removed helps you determine if the issue is related to content relevance, competitor activity, or technical accessibility.

Assess whether competitor content has successfully replaced your blog posts in Meta AI by reviewing the current sources cited in those specific answers. Use technical diagnostics to ensure your content remains fully discoverable by AI crawlers, preventing future visibility losses due to formatting or access issues.

  • Review the context of AI answers where your brand was previously cited to understand why the mention was removed
  • Assess if competitor content has replaced your blog posts in Meta AI by comparing your presence against industry rivals
  • Use technical diagnostics to ensure your content remains discoverable by AI crawlers and is formatted for optimal extraction
  • Implement content updates based on the identified gaps to regain your position in relevant AI-generated responses

Why would a blog post lose its citation status in Meta AI if the content hasn't changed?

AI platforms frequently update their training data and retrieval logic, which can cause them to favor different sources over time. Even without content changes, competitor activity or shifts in AI model preferences can lead to a loss of citation status.
